Flip Chip Technology Market Drivers
Increasing Demand for Miniaturization in Electronics
The Flip Chip Technology Market Industry is experiencing significant growth driven by the increasing demand for miniaturization of electronic devices. With consumer electronics becoming smaller, lighter, and more powerful, manufacturers are seeking advanced packaging technologies like flip chip to fit more functionality into compact spaces. As per the International Telecommunication Union, global mobile phone subscriptions reached approximately 8.9 billion in 2022.
This high penetration rate underscores the necessity for advanced technologies that support the increasing number of electronic devices, thereby pushing the demand for flip chip technology. Major companies such as Intel and Samsung are now investing heavily in research and development of flip chip technologies to create compact and efficient products, further validating the growth potential and necessity for the flip chip technology in the electronics sector.
Rising Investment in Automotive Electronics
The automotive industry is increasingly integrating advanced electronics into vehicles for features like advanced driver-assistance systems (ADAS), infotainment, and connectivity. This trend is significantly boosting the Flip Chip Technology Market Industry. According to the Global Automotive Executive Survey by Deloitte, 61% of executives expect a substantial increase in the deployment of electronics in new vehicles by 2030. Companies like Tesla and Toyota are leading the charge with high-tech features in vehicles, thus heightening the need for innovative packaging solutions such as flip chips which are efficient and can handle high thermals while maintaining reliability.
This resurgence in automotive electronics will further stimulate the demand for flip chip technology.
Advancements in Wireless Communication Technologies
The rapid advancement in wireless communication technologies, such as 5G, is driving the Flip Chip Technology Market Industry. Research from the Global System for Mobile Communications Association indicates that by 2025, 5G will cover one-third of the global population, increasing the demand for devices that can support high-speed communication. The need for flip chip technology arises from its ability to provide a higher inductor-capacitance ratio that enhances the performance of radio frequency devices, essential for 5G networks.
Major telecommunications companies like Qualcomm and Ericsson are heavily investing in developing the necessary components, hence fostering the demand for advanced packaging solutions like flip chip technology in line with wireless advancements.

Flip Chip Technology Market Material Insights
The Flip Chip Technology Market, with a value of 44.29 billion USD in 2024, is experiencing substantial growth driven by the increasing demand for efficient processing and miniaturization in electronic components. Within the Material segment, Conductive Adhesives play a crucial role, offering reliable electrical connectivity while minimizing the space required for assembly, making them essential in compact applications. Solder Balls, known for their thermal and electrical conductivity, dominate this market landscape, supporting high-performance chip designs.
Underfill Materials are significant as they enhance thermal stability and protect components from mechanical stress, thus prolonging the lifespan of electronic devices. Protective Coatings contribute to this market by providing moisture and contamination resistance, essential for maintaining device integrity. The growing emphasis on advanced packaging solutions reflects strong trends towards innovation within the Flip Chip Technology Market industry, with these materials being key to meeting the evolving needs of modern electronic applications.

Flip Chip Technology Market Regional Insights
The Flip Chip Technology Market has shown substantial growth across various regions, with North America held a significant market share valued at 15.0 USD Billion in 2024 and projected to reach 24.9 USD Billion by 2035, due to strong demand from the electronics sector. Europe follows closely with a valuation of 11.0 USD Billion in 2024, increasing to 18.5 USD Billion by 2035, driven by advancements in automotive and consumer electronics applications. The Asia Pacific region, valued at 12.29 USD Billion in 2024, will see an increase to 20.29 USD Billion in 2035, attributed to the growing manufacturing capabilities in countries like China and Taiwan.
South America and the Middle East and Africa, while smaller in comparison, show potential for growth; South America was valued at 3.0 USD Billion in 2024, rising to 4.95 USD Billion in 2035, and the Middle East and Africa market stands at 3.0 USD Billion in 2024, expected to reach 5.86 USD Billion by 2035. The majority holding in the market indicates that North America and Asia Pacific are leading in innovation and production, suggesting robust opportunities for market players. The increasing adoption of smart devices and advancements in semiconductor technology further contribute to the regional dynamics of the Flip Chip Technology Market.
